Output e68018053fc478066a3abc1895dc149a8f1dffeb76ec810546f82550f6cc8162:1

value
129140163
script pubkey
OP_0 OP_PUSHBYTES_20 ec5556870140fc62cfee16b1b75a7829ec0f09a8
address
bc1qa324dpcpgr7x9nlwz6cmwknc98kq7zdgymwng7
transaction
e68018053fc478066a3abc1895dc149a8f1dffeb76ec810546f82550f6cc8162
spent
true